The Nasty Problem of Food Processing Wastewater
Food processing plants generate a ton of wastewater. This stuff is no joke. It’s full of all sorts of gross stuff like oils, grease, food particles, proteins, and carbohydrates. These contaminants can really mess up the environment if they’re not treated properly. Just imagine untreated wastewater flowing into rivers or lakes. It can cause oxygen depletion, kill fish and other aquatic life, and make the water all murky and stinky.
How Air Flotation Machines Work
Okay, so let’s talk about how our air flotation machines come to the rescue. The basic idea behind an air flotation machine is to use tiny bubbles to lift contaminants to the surface of the wastewater. It’s like magic in a way.
Here’s how the process goes. First, the wastewater is pumped into the air flotation tank. Then, we inject a whole bunch of tiny air bubbles into the water. These bubbles attach themselves to the contaminants in the water, whether it’s oil droplets, suspended solids, or other junk. As the bubbles rise to the surface, they carry the contaminants with them.
At the top of the tank, we have a mechanism that skims off the layer of floating contaminants, which is called the sludge. This sludge can then be removed and properly disposed of. Meanwhile, the cleaner water at the bottom of the tank can be further treated or discharged, depending on local regulations.
The Treatment Effect on Different Contaminants
Oils and Grease
One of the biggest problems in food processing wastewater is oils and grease. These substances are not only bad for the environment but can also clog up pipes and treatment systems. Our air flotation machines are really good at removing oils and grease. The tiny air bubbles have a strong affinity for oil droplets. They stick to the oil and make it rise to the surface.
In most cases, we can achieve an oil and grease removal efficiency of over 90%. That’s a huge deal! It means that the wastewater leaving the air flotation machine is much cleaner and less likely to cause problems downstream.
Suspended Solids
Food processing wastewater also contains a lot of suspended solids, like food particles, fibers, and dirt. These solids can make the water look cloudy and can cause issues in treatment processes. Our air flotation machines are great at removing suspended solids too.
The air bubbles attach to the solids and lift them to the surface. We’ve found that our machines can typically remove between 80% and 95% of the suspended solids in the wastewater. This significantly reduces the turbidity of the water and makes it easier to treat further.
Organic Matter
Organic matter, such as proteins and carbohydrates, is another common contaminant in food processing wastewater. These substances can consume oxygen in the water, leading to oxygen depletion and harming aquatic life.
Our air flotation machines can help reduce the amount of organic matter in the wastewater. By removing the suspended solids and oils that often contain organic matter, we can lower the biochemical oxygen demand (BOD) of the water. We usually see a BOD reduction of around 50% to 70% after the wastewater goes through our air flotation machine.
